#040446 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#040446 is composed of 1.6% red, 1.6%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.3% cyan, 94.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 72.5% black. It has a hue angle of 240 degrees, a saturation of 89.2% and a lightness of 14.5%. #040446 color hex could be obtained by blending #08088c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

Shades and Tints of #040446
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01010e is the darkest color, while #fbfb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#040446
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#232327 is the less saturated color, while #010149 is the most saturated one.
